Having just been through this over the past 6 weeks, let me offer a bit of advice if you're into comps.

Stations are cumulative comps- in other words, every minute you play earns you comp dollars. But they also subtract EVERYTHING from that total. They even subtract a pack of cigarettes, billing it at $5. My wife and I have played together on the same card for hours, and asked for a pack of cigs (filthy habit, we admit) and were told the pack we got 2 days ago at another station put us below even on comp dollars. We're down $50 for the night and they give us a hard time for tobacco?!?!? Drinks aren't subtracted, but they're hard to get.

Coast casino (SPECIFICALLY THE ORLEANS) has a much more liberal drink and tobacco policy. What they don't do is accumulate points. If you play at a level to get a free meal at a good restaurant ($5/hand for a few hours) you get it. And that's a great deal, because their restaurants are good. But you'd better take it that night. While strip casinos will add your play up to score a room. These guys won't. Take what you get the night you get it. No carry-over. This very night I looked at a pit boss who's watched my wife and I play a total of 70 hours at $10/hand average over the past month and never awarded us a comp, and I told him we'd like to stay later, but I need to drive home. Can I get a room? He told me that if I'm not playing $50 to $75 a hand, rooms are impossible. He reiterated that play isn't cumulative at the Orleans.

As for limits- I stick to larger "locals" places like Coasts and Stations. But for the best blackjack in hand I recommend going to The Sahara. $1 blackjack tables are easier to get than a $5 on the strip. $2 blackjack is simple. At the Coasts, $5 blackjack is a search but do-able, $2 craps is easy.

Please keep in mind that I have no gripe with anyone's comp policy. I just think the player shoudl know what it is.

Also, playing poker at The Palms for 2 hours at a 2-4 Hold 'Em game has scored me a $5 meal ticket without asking. That's the most generous I've experienced anywhere. (AND NO- THEY DIDN'T KNOW I KNEW GENE)
